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
017355438 80954194 850525 73364914 45263
94123634 6605 55040400188
94123634 6605 55040400188
706762 6350 76383
All about undefined
Interested in learning more?
94123634 6605 55040400188
706762 6350 76383
See more
371173927 40891 2084
19746176 3956 989
See more
78 913235439
416137905 20 26154 5980204 4015
See more